Flight Costs — Kolkata to Srinagar (Return)

AirlineRouteReturn Fare RangeDuration
IndiGoKolkata → Srinagar (direct)₹8,000–₹16,000~3 hrs
Air IndiaKolkata → Srinagar (direct)₹10,000–₹20,000~3 hrs
SpiceJet / Go FirstKolkata → Srinagar (direct)₹9,000–₹18,000~3 hrs
Any (via Delhi)Kolkata → Delhi → Srinagar₹7,000–₹14,000~5–7 hrs

📅 Best prices: Book 4–6 weeks in advance. Peak prices during school holidays (May, October) — book 2+ months ahead.

Kashmir Trip Cost Comparison (per couple, 6N/7D)

Cost ItemBudgetMid-RangeLuxury
Return flights (Kolkata ↔ Srinagar, direct or via Delhi)₹8,000–₹14,000₹12,000–₹20,000₹25,000–₹45,000 (business)
Dal Lake Houseboat (per couple per night)₹3,000–₹6,000 (standard category)₹6,000–₹12,000 (deluxe/1-star)₹15,000–₹40,000 (super deluxe 5-star)
Hotels (Gulmarg, Pahalgam, Sonamarg, 5 nights total)₹10,000–₹18,000₹20,000–₹40,000₹55,000–₹1,20,000
Gulmarg Gondola (Phase I + II, 2 pax)₹2,500–₹3,000 (Phase I only)₹3,500–₹4,500 (both phases)₹4,500–₹5,000 (both phases)
Private vehicle (entire 6-day trip)₹8,000–₹14,000 (sharing/SUV)₹14,000–₹22,000 (private SUV)₹22,000–₹35,000 (luxury SUV)
Shikara ride, horse riding, snow activities₹2,000–₹4,000₹4,000–₹8,000₹8,000–₹18,000
Food (6 days, per couple)₹4,000–₹8,000 (local dhabas)₹8,000–₹16,000 (hotels/restaurants)₹18,000–₹40,000+
Total estimate (6N/7D, per couple)₹40,000–₹70,000₹75,000–₹1,30,000₹1,60,000–₹3,00,000+

Key Activities & Their Costs

Shikara Ride (Dal Lake, 1 hr)

₹400–₹800 per shikara (not per person)

Non-negotiable experience. Sunrise shikara rides (6–7 AM) offer the best light and a peaceful lake.

Gulmarg Gondola (Phase I + II)

₹1,700–₹2,000 per person (both phases)

One of Asia's highest gondola rides. Phase II (Apharwat, 3,980 m) offers Himalayan panoramas. Book online to avoid queues.

Horse Riding — Pahalgam / Gulmarg

₹500–₹2,500 depending on route length

Government-fixed rates apply. Fixed rate card must be displayed by all horse operators — ask to see it before agreeing.

Snow Activities — Gulmarg (winter)

₹1,500–₹5,000 (skiing lesson + equipment)

Gulmarg is India's premier ski resort with HSKI (Himalayan Ski Village) runs. Skiing lessons with instructor: ₹2,000–₹5,000.

Mughal Gardens Entry (Nishat, Shalimar, Chashme Shahi)

₹24–₹40 per adult per garden

Three major Mughal gardens are clustered around Dal Lake — all within 10–15 km of each other. Book a garden-combined half-day excursion.

Sonamarg Day Trip (from Srinagar)

₹4,000–₹8,000 per vehicle (private), ₹500–₹1,000 per person (shared)

Sonamarg ('Meadow of Gold') at 2,800 m — white water rivers, glaciers, and trekking to Thajiwas Glacier. Pony rides to Thajiwas: ₹500–₹1,000.

Money-Saving Tips for Kashmir from Kolkata

Book direct Kolkata–Srinagar flights 4–6 weeks ahead. Fares spike during Eid holidays, Kashmir tulip festival (March–April), and Indian summer holidays.
Travel as a group (4–6 people) — private vehicle costs are per vehicle, so cost per person halves when shared by a group.
Choose a houseboat for 2–3 nights rather than the full trip — it's the signature Kashmir experience but you don't need to spend every night there.
Book Gulmarg Gondola online in advance (gulmarg.nic.in or GGTC official site) — saves queuing and occasionally saves 10–15% vs. spot price.
Eat at local Wazwan restaurants in Srinagar (inside the city, near Lal Chowk) rather than hotel restaurants — equal quality at 50% the price.
Spring (March–May) and autumn (October–November) are peak seasons for scenery but mid-June and September offer nearly identical landscapes at 20–30% lower prices.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How much does a Kashmir trip cost from Kolkata per couple?

A: A comfortable 6N/7D Kashmir trip from Kolkata for a couple costs ₹75,000–₹1,30,000 (mid-range) covering return flights, 2 nights Dal Lake houseboat, hotels in Gulmarg/Pahalgam, private SUV, Gulmarg gondola, shikara ride, and meals. A budget trip can be done for ₹40,000–₹70,000 per couple with standard houseboats and shared vehicles. Luxury packages with 5-star Dal Lake properties range from ₹1,60,000–₹3,00,000+.

Q: How do I fly from Kolkata to Kashmir (Srinagar)?

A: Direct flights operate from Kolkata to Srinagar (SXR) — IndiGo and Air India both fly this route directly in approximately 3 hours. Return fares are typically ₹8,000–₹20,000 depending on booking lead time and season. Alternatively, connecting via Delhi (1 stop) is often cheaper but adds 3–4 hours. Book 4–6 weeks ahead for best prices.

Q: What is the best time to visit Kashmir from Kolkata?

A: Kashmir has distinct seasonal experiences: March–May (spring — tulip gardens, mild weather), June–September (summer — lush green valleys, best trekking, Amarnath Yatra), October–November (autumn — chinar trees turn golden, stunning landscapes), and December–February (winter — Gulmarg skiing, Pahalgam snowfall, frozen Dal Lake). Avoid the peak Indian holiday season (April–May, October) for lower prices — book 2+ months ahead.

Q: Is the Dal Lake houseboat experience worth it?

A: Yes — staying on a traditional Kashmiri houseboat on Dal Lake is one of India's most unique hospitality experiences. Waking up on the lake, taking the morning shikara ride through the floating vegetable market, and watching the Pir Panjal range at sunset from the deck are memories that last a lifetime. Choose houseboats rated 'deluxe' or above — standard-category boats can be poorly maintained. Full-board packages (meals included) are recommended.

Q: How much does the Gulmarg Gondola cost?

A: The Gulmarg Gondola operates in two phases: Phase I (Gulmarg to Kongdori, 2,650 m to 3,088 m) costs approximately ₹840–₹920 per adult. Phase II (Kongdori to Apharwat Peak, 3,088 m to 3,980 m) costs approximately ₹900–₹1,000 additional. Total for both phases for two adults: approximately ₹3,500–₹4,500. Book online on the GGTC (Gulmarg Gondola) official website to avoid queues — Phase II must be booked separately.

Q: Is Kashmir safe to visit in 2026?

A: Kashmir has seen significant improvement in the security situation and tourist infrastructure since 2019. The region receives millions of tourists annually, and major destinations like Srinagar, Gulmarg, Pahalgam, and Sonamarg are well-monitored and tourist-friendly.
